    The Use of Intertextuality to Enhance EFL Students’ Cultural Awareness Case of Study: EFL Master One Students
    (UNIVERSITY OF ABBES LAGHROUR-KHENCHELA, 2019) . AOUGAB Naima - . LAACISSE Narimen
    Abstract This research aims to investigate the use of intertextuality to enhance EFL students’ cultural awareness at Abbes Laghrour University. Intertextuality is a very important approach in which students should be aware of and master, this study is consisted with three major questions to outline EFL teachers’ and students’ view point toward intertextuality. We have adopted a descriptive research methodology and a one data collection tool: two questionnaires assigned for fifteen teachers and fifty nine students. The discussion and the results revealed the effectiveness of intertextuality in improving EFL learners’ cultural awareness.
